Childe Hassam's Veranda: A Study in Light and Atmosphere

Childe Hassam's Veranda Of The Old House exemplifies the artist's mastery of capturing fleeting moments of light and atmosphere. This work, though undated, reflects Hassam's signature Impressionist style, where the interplay of sunlight and shadow takes center stage. The veranda, a recurring motif in Hassam's oeuvre, serves as a frame within the frame, inviting viewers into a tranquil domestic space while simultaneously drawing attention to the natural world beyond.

The composition reveals Hassam's debt to French Impressionism, particularly in its loose brushwork and emphasis on optical effects. Yet it remains distinctly American in its subject matter—a quiet corner of New England rather than a Parisian boulevard. As the Metropolitan Museum of Art notes in its overview of American Impressionism, artists like Hassam "adapted European techniques to create a uniquely American visual language" (metmuseum.org). This synthesis of influences is evident in the way Hassam renders both the architectural details of the veranda and the dappled light filtering through unseen foliage.

The American Impressionist Moment

Hassam emerged as a leading figure in American Impressionism during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Unlike his European counterparts who often focused on urban modernity, Hassam frequently turned his attention to the American landscape and domestic architecture. Veranda Of The Old House belongs to a series of works where Hassam explores the interplay between interior and exterior spaces, a theme that occupied him throughout his career.

The veranda functions as a liminal space in this composition, neither fully indoors nor outdoors. This ambiguity allows Hassam to experiment with light effects that were central to Impressionist technique. The artist's brushwork becomes particularly expressive in the sunlit areas, where thick impasto captures the intensity of daylight. In shadowed sections, by contrast, his touch grows more subdued, creating a visual rhythm across the canvas.

In this work, Hassam demonstrates how American Impressionism could transform ordinary domestic architecture into a stage for the drama of light and atmosphere.

Technical Mastery in Veranda Of The Old House

Composition and Spatial Organization

Hassam structures the composition around strong diagonal lines that draw the viewer's eye from the foreground into the middle ground. The veranda's wooden railing creates a series of repeating vertical elements that contrast with the horizontal planes of the floor and unseen horizon. This geometric framework provides stability to what might otherwise become an overwhelming play of light.

Color and Light

The artist's palette here relies heavily on warm ochres and cool blues to create depth and atmosphere. Hassam applies these colors in broken strokes that allow the white ground to show through in places, enhancing the overall luminosity. Particularly effective is his handling of the sunlight that appears to filter through some unseen foliage, creating a pattern of shifting light and shadow across the veranda's surface.
